Type
ORACLE
Validation date
2024-02-13 21:18:12 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.03865,
    "usd": 0.0414
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00017AB296348D8E73281F2C4AE324E5FF4149F50A0747BA7A13D56318D5F547C34D

Previous signature

C1F9938D885B29E2C1CDB3CCFE7CDFB1240C2118D0F46269C87E418B34738CB9323818E63651D15F5816E72F522D5F8901F5C0E7C93CBFE3C1869761A8523801

Origin signature

3046022100BE2FC98E0AD95431AFE8F88EFA4BCFD70860C5C11A125443C28004754F6DFC31022100A26C8954E7BD80198018CB63EBAB8C28A9C78A704C89F87EF938395E5510EB22

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

006A9EC7F04B519B66EB43070F2AF7FFC2C332CE3C1EBBA6598F1FC8AF9A62F6B1

Coordinator signature

792551689A56C43169B3296484AAEA661916CAF118D9121ACE95E6F9B53936D9F295AE981442F496674B8180FFA932D8856D7B4F897EF99D5924CC0A3482BD07

Validator #1 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#1 signature

65CC03A723D38086E17822A710FD391270590F711A785D6FE3276D7E2197F89A49DD18C4C7B23A7EB47E289E60D69EB187D056079A1DDCA01F76AC39AEE1DD0A

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

FA52E65930C9E4E340D61037A9FE8D39D47C8A60C3B3BB51B1269FEF9D8C2A6EE02C2B91D0A4F943225A5231E43AB3F8B82F8BD3F14A2A3A0ACADAACAE27FC07